Many new books come out in autumn. The literature fair Lit.Cologne Spezial therefore takes care of novelties and current topics. Bestselling author Charlotte Link will be there, Günter Wallraff will speak about investigative journalism.

Cologne (dpa/lnw) - The Lit.Cologne Spezial starts on Wednesday in Cologne (7.30 p.m.) with a reading by the successful author Ferdinand von Schirach. The literature festival presents book highlights of the autumn. In addition to the presentation of outstanding literary titles, according to the organizers, this year's program will also focus on current issues and discussions.

Günter Wallraff, who has just turned 80, talks about investigative journalism, bestselling author Charlotte Link comes with her new crime thriller. The American political scientist Francis Fukuyama presents his current book "Liberalism and its Enemies".

The issue of the Lit.Cologne Spezial lasts from October 5th to 9th and also has special dates on October 22nd and 24th. It takes place in the vicinity of the Frankfurt Book Fair. The literature fair Lit.Cologne is held in spring.
